Leadership Houston, a top organization developing Houstons civic leaders, and the Museum of Cultural Arts, Houston (MOCAH), the citys most prominent public art developer, proudly unveiled the first public art project in the city to honor Houstons broad diversity.
This is Houston was created as a unique art concept and community action project designed to beautiful our city and raise awareness of diversity by Leadership Houston Class XXVII. The tile mosaic mural includes images in the categories of art/diversity, education, the environment, healthcare, and leadership. Its a one-of-a-kind iconic artwork designed to be a legacy and pay homage to our city.
The 6 ft. x 30 ft. custom mosaic mural will be permanently on display as a gift to the community of Montrose and the city of Houston at 2615 Montrose Boulevard at California Street, on the Hubbard Financial Services Building.
The artistic design of this mural was facilitated by MOCAH co-founder and artist, Reginald Adams.
The $25,000+ project was made possible by Class XXVII and community partners: Waste Management, United Way of Greater Houston, Ursula and Angel Jimenez, CenterPoint Energy, AT&T, Chamberlin Roofing and Waterproofing, JE Dunn, Texas Business Alliance, and Hubbard Financial Services.
